Polestar’s new electrical SUV, the Polestar 4, is ready to hit the Korean market in June, Hyundai and Kia’s house turf.
The brand new absolutely electrical “SUV Coupe” is making its debut in key international markets. Polestar 4 manufacturing started in mid-November in China.
By the top of 2023, Polestar stated it delivered its first 880 fashions to clients. Earlier this yr, Polestar launched its new electrical SUV in Europe and Australia. In Europe, the Polestar 4 begins at EUR 63,200 ($68,500), and in Australia, it’ll price you AUD 81,500 ($53,700).
Polestar’s new electrical SUV made its North American debut on the NY Auto Present final month. The automaker introduced Polestar 4 costs will begin at $56,300 within the US with as much as 300 miles vary.
That’s lower than the anticipated $60,000 worth goal. The bottom, Lengthy Vary Single Motor variant options 272 hp and 253 lb-ft of torque for a 0 to 60 mph time in 7.4 seconds.
The extra highly effective Lengthy Vary Twin Motor variant begins at $64,300 with as much as 270 miles vary. It packs 544 hp and 506 lb-ft of torque for a 0 to 60 mph dash in 3.7 seconds.
With the added Plus and Efficiency packages, Polestar 4 costs can run upwards of $74,300. Different non-compulsory packages embrace Pilot (+$1,500) and Professional (+$2,000).
The Polestar 4 is anticipated to compete with Tesla’s best-selling Mannequin Y (though Polestar doesn’t see Tesla as its competitors) and the brand new Porsche Macan. Now, Polestar’s new electrical SUV is about to hit Hyundai and Kia’s house market.
Polestar’s new electrical SUV to tackle Hyundai and Kia
Polestar already introduced it might contract manufacture the 4 in a Busan, South Korea manufacturing facility final yr.
Renault Korea Motors owns the plant, which is its largest plant in Asia. Polestar’s 4 would be the first EV constructed on the facility and will likely be produced for the Korean and North American markets.
Polestar introduced on Friday that it’ll launch its new electrical SUV in Korea in June. Deliveries are anticipated to kick off in October.
“We’re engaged on numerous preparatory measures akin to certification, and we’ll do our greatest to launch (the automobile) in June and ship it to (clients) in October.”
The Polestar 4 would be the second electrical SUV to hit the Korean market, following the Polestar 3. One of the vital distinctive options is the Polestar 4’s lack of a rear window.
Polestar says this helps maximize inside house whereas offering a modern silhouette. The automobile’s digicam system offers a transparent view of its environment, together with the rear.
With a 100 kWh battery, Polestar goals for the electrical SUV to supply as much as 379 miles (610 km) WLTP driving vary.
Costs have but to be revealed, however Polestar’s new electrical SUV is anticipated to simply high Hyundai and Kia electrical fashions at over $55,000.

In 2023, Hyundai and Kia accounted for over 90% of home automobile manufacturing in Korea. Hyundai had 52% of the share, whereas Kia had 39%. Each automakers’ gross sales elevated, with Hyundai’s up 10.6% and Kia’s advancing 4.6% yr over yr.
In the meantime, Polestar is a premium EV maker with a distinct segment market. Polestar shouldn’t be anticipated to promote hundreds of thousands of automobiles, but it surely might rival high fashions just like the Kia EV9 or the upcoming Hyundai IONIQ 9.
Korea is a key marketplace for luxurious automakers like Porsche, Mercedes-Benz, and BMW. It’s among the many high three Asia markets for international luxurious manufacturers. For instance, round 34,000 automobiles priced over $108,000 (150 million Received) had been offered final yr, based on KAIDA and trade figures.
Nonetheless, a brand new authorities rule requiring firm vehicles price over $58,000 to put on a shiny neon inexperienced license plate is popping away consumers.
